One of the tips in starting a work from a home online business is finding the right idea. The right thing to do is taking your time to figure out something that you will be good at. The other thing is that it is recommended that you have passion for the idea that you have come up as this will help in propelling you forward. The other thing that you should consider is the market as you need to confident that you will receive customers in your areas. With all these, you would have set grounds for the business that you want to run from home.
The second tip is to market your business. Let say that as we speak you have identified your products, services, and ideas and now what is remaining is rolling out. But the big question is whether your business is known or not. Therefore, it is time you let people know about your work from online business through marketing. Some of the things that you should do is utilize paid adverts and SEO among other things that will promote your business. Remember that when you market your business properly you will get many customers. This is something that you can achieve by hiring the services of a professional marketing company especially if you are not good at it.
Last but not least, you should not do it on your own. One thing that you need to understand that a business is not just something that you can handle all the processes easily on your own. You will be on the safe side if you dwell on things you do best and tasks that you can manage. The rest of the complicated tasks such as bookkeeping, accounting, and others you should outsource. In a business where people do what they are good at there is no doubt that you will get a better outcome.
